Using this add-on, users can now become characters that are animated in a 2D/3D style more closely mimicking the animation you are used to watching in your favorite shows. While the avatars that come with the original program are traditional CG characters, a new module that was recently released allows you to live out your anime fantasies. Users can record video or stream the results to anything that normally uses an active webcam like Skype, Twitch, or Hangouts. FaceRig maps and tracks your face and transfers that movement to the face of a fully animated avatar. But to say that FaceRig is simply a filter is not giving the program proper credit.
